Title: Re: LinkStation Live Bittorrent does not start
Post by: AngelsAbys on June 10, 2010, 08:42:43 AM

For the LS-CHLv2 and the LS-XHL, there was a firmware update to v 1.31, which focuses on the bittorrent side and the UPS side.  Suggested to try and download the updated firmware to resolve bittorrent complications

Title: Re: LinkStation Live Bittorrent does not start
Post by: Thaitawat on June 14, 2010, 11:12:17 PM

- Initialize the LinkStation. (System-Restore)

- Create new folder for torrent.

- Change download folder to new folder. (Extention-Bittorent)

- Change port to 58500 (Download manager)
